    The Luverne amateur baseball team won three more games this week to raise its record to 11-1 for the abbreviated 2020 season. The Redbirds defeated the Renner Bullets July 8 before picking up road wins over the Renner Monarchs July 9 and the Hadley Buttermakers July 11.     When looking at local dirt track racing results, it’s not unusual to see the name Kracht published in the newspaper. Just this week, four different Krachts raced in three different classes at Rapid Speedway in Rock Rapids.     Verbrugge records hole-in-one Missy Verbrugge of Luverne recorded her first hole-in-one while playing at Luverne Country Club Sunday. Verbrugge’s ace occurred on the third hole at LCC where she used a pitching wedge to send the ball approximately 90 yards to the green. It rolled about five yards before dropping into the hole.     Participants in the annual Davis Lake Triathlon competed in warm weather Saturday morning. The triathlon, which is always staged on the morning of July 4 at The Lake in southwest Luverne, included two different races.     Isaiah Bartels, a 2020 Luverne High School graduate, was named to the 2019-2020 Academic All-State Boys Basketball team this spring. The award is presented by the Minnesota Basketball Coaches Association.
